AbstractThis article is a book review on "China's Challenge" by Michael Yahuda. This book is one of the most recent of the countless academic and journalistic essays published in Hong Kong and abroad on the subject of the handover of the British colony to the People's Republic of China on July 1st, 1997. However, from the very start, this work claims to be very different from the others: its purpose is not to look at the change of sovereighty and its consequences from the point of view of Hong Kong and its people, but rather to measure the significance of this event for China by analysing the numerous challenges which Hong Kong's return poses for the Chinese government at a critical moment in its history.
